Ok. I'm working on Finns right now for FoW and I need a bunch of artillery and anti-tank gun crew right now that are not in Winter gear. Does anyone know of a manufacturer of 15mm scale Finnish gun crews that is not Battlefront? I don't need 2/3 of what's in the special order artillery group blister since that blister also comes with the heavy mortar platoon which I already have.

If I can't find these then my only other option is to risk the wrath of the Rivet Counters and just paint up some German Heer figures in Finnish colors and go from there…

Sarmor20 Feb 2014 7:56 a.m. PST

I have the same problem… AFAIK the only manufacturers of 15mm Finns are Battlefront, Resistant Roosters and East Riding Miniatures, and only Battlefront makes artillery crews.
